  • Instructions for American Servicemen in France during World War II
  • Written by author United States Army
  • Published by University of Chicago Press, 11/15/2008
  • "You are about to play a personal part in pushing the Germans out of France. Whatever part you take—rifleman, hospital orderly, mechanic, pilot, clerk, gunner, truck driver—you will be an essential factor in a great effort." As American soldier

Contents
I Why You're Going to France......5
II The United States Soldier in France..9
Meet the People................9
Security and Health............15
You Are a Guest of France......18
Mademoiselle...................19
III A Few Pages of French History.......21
Occupation.....................21
Resistance.....................25
Necessary Surgery..............26
A Quick Look Back..............27
Churchgoers....................29
The Machinery..................30
IV Oberservation Post...................33
The Provinces...................33
The Cafes.......................34
The Farms.......................40
The Regions.....................43
The Workers.....................47
The Tourist.....................49
V In Parting............................58
VI Annex: various Aids..................60
Decimal System..................60
Language Guide..................62
Important Signs.....(Outside back cover)
